Embarking on the journey to parenthood can be filled with thrill, but sometimes it requires a helping hand. For couples facing fertility challenges, In Vitro Fertilization (IVF) offers a beacon of hope. This revolutionary process involves combining an egg and sperm in a laboratory setting, ultimately leading to the creation of an embryo that is transferred into the uterus.
While IVF can seem daunting, understanding the phases involved can empower you to make informed choices. A typical IVF cycle features several key procedures: ovarian stimulation to harvest multiple eggs, retrieval of those eggs, fertilization in the lab, embryo development, and finally, implantation of the chosen embryo(s) into the uterus.
Throughout this process, you'll have a team of dedicated medical professionals guiding you every step of the way. They'll provide guidance, answer your questions, and help you navigate the emotional and physical transitions that come with IVF.

Hope in Every Embryo: Exploring IVF and Fertility Treatments
For families struggling with infertility, the path to parenthood can feel difficult. However, cutting-edge treatments offer a chance for new beginnings through in vitro fertilization (IVF) and various fertility treatments. IVF, a transformative procedure, requires the fertilization of an egg by a sperm in a controlled environment the body. This fertilized egg is then placed back into the mother's reproductive system, offering a extraordinary opportunity to achieve pregnancy and welcome a child into the world.
Beyond IVF, a variety of fertility treatments are available to tackle different causes of infertility. These include drug treatments to promote egg release, operative interventions to remedy reproductive issues, and embryo donation.
